Background
Water pumps are machines that deliver or pressurize a liquid. It transfers the mechanical energy of prime mover or other external energy to liquid to increase the energy of liquid, and is mainly used to transfer liquid including water, oil, acid-base liquid, emulsion, suspoemulsion and liquid metal. Liquids, gas mixtures, and liquids containing suspended solids may also be transported. The technical parameters of the water pump performance include flow, suction lift, shaft power, water power, efficiency and the like; the pump can be divided into a volume water pump, a vane pump and the like according to different working principles. The displacement pump transfers energy by utilizing the change of the volume of a working chamber; vane pumps transfer energy by the interaction of rotating vanes with water and are available in the types of centrifugal pumps, axial flow pumps, mixed flow pumps, and the like.
The existing water pump usually adopts a mode of using threaded connection to fix the impeller, and is very inconvenient in overhauling, assembling and disassembling.

In further detail, the plurality of blocking blocks 34 correspond to the plurality of wedge-shaped fixture blocks 35 in the axial direction of the rear wind sleeve 31 one by one, so that when the rear wind sleeve 31 is installed after the barrel 1 is installed, the installed barrel 1 firstly passes through the plurality of wedge-shaped fixture blocks 35 and then enters the plurality of installation grooves 33, and then is blocked by the plurality of blocking blocks 34, so that the rear wind sleeve 31 is fixed on the installed barrel 1.
In further detail, a circular through hole is formed in the middle of the ventilation hood 32, after the rotor is installed on the machine barrel 1, the impeller is installed on the extending shaft, and then the extending shaft rotates in the circular through hole formed in the middle of the ventilation hood 32, so that the vibration of the rotation of the impeller can be reduced, and the stability of the rotation is improved.
In further detail, the mounting cylinder 1 comprises a cylinder 11, a protruding ring 14 fixedly connected inside the cylinder 11, two supporting bottom plates 12 fixedly connected to the lower end of the cylinder 11, two side reinforcing ribs 13 fixedly connected between the two supporting bottom plates 12 and the cylinder 11 for increasing the strength of the two supporting bottom plates 12, and a mounting ring 18 fixedly connected to the right side of the cylinder 11, the mounting of the rear air cover 3 is performed through the mounting ring 18, the supporting bottom plates 12 are arranged to provide a larger supporting point for the cylinder 11, and then the bearing capacity of the two supporting bottom plates 12 is increased through the side reinforcing ribs 13 arranged between each supporting bottom plate 12 and the cylinder 11, so that the device has more stable support in operation, and the mounting position of the mounting cover is limited through the protruding ring 14 arranged inside.
In further detail, two mounting grooves are formed in each of the two support bottom plates 12, and bolts screwed into the mounting holes can be fixed at required positions.
In further detail, a plurality of protruding sliding blocks 19 are evenly distributed on the mounting ring 18 in the circumferential direction, and a certain gap can be reserved between the rear fan housing 3 and the machine barrel 11 when the rear fan housing 3 is mounted through the protruding sliding blocks, so that the air flow generated when the impeller rotates can take away heat for cooling.
Further in detail, installation barrel 1 still include terminal box connecting box 15 of rigid coupling in barrel 11 upper end, and rigid coupling at terminal box connecting box 15 and the ground connection connecting block 16 on barrel 11, and the ground connection suggestion sign 17 of rigid coupling on barrel 11, both sides all are provided with installation groove ear 151 around terminal box connecting box 15, can remind the installer not to omit ground connection processing with barrel 11 when the installation through ground connection suggestion sign 17, reach the purpose of safe installation in proper order, just can accomplish ground connection processing to barrel 11 through connecting wire and ground intercommunication in ground connection connecting block 16, also carry out ground connection processing with the device is whole simultaneously.
Further in detail, terminal box 2 including can dismantle two fixture blocks 23 of connection in box connecting box 15 front and back both sides installation groove ear 151, and the extension piece 22 of rigid coupling in two fixture block 23 upper ends, and the equal rigid coupling in front and back both ends has the junction box body 21 of extension piece 22, junction box body 21 upper portion is provided with the through-hole, make and form regional the condition that can outwards extend connecting wire in forming after sliding into box connecting box 15 front and back both sides installation groove ear respectively through two fixture blocks 23, press two fixture blocks 23 inboard through inwards simultaneously when dismantling the inspection, later upwards stimulate junction box body 21, can enough start just the inspection with two fixture blocks 23 roll-off, accomplish the dismantlement, very convenient and fast.
In more detail, the two latch blocks 23 are made of rubber, so that the initial state can be maintained and certain elasticity can be maintained after the latch blocks 23 are used for multiple times.
